John Gormley reported on Twitter the other day that Saskatchewan has 102 degrees of temperature swing between its all time low and all time high.
The lowest recorded temperature in Saskatchewan was in Prince Albert in 1893, with a low of -56.7°C. . . talk about cold!
Our highest recorded temperature was in Midale/Yellow Grass in 1937 when the mercury peaked at +45°C . Mighty warm!
Alberta has a swing of 104; British Columbia 103. Now, that’s some weather worth talking about!
